A Match Made in Hollywood
Guess Who's Coming to Dinner is a perfect example of Sidney Poitier's versatility and range as an actor. He plays John Prentice, a successful doctor who returns home to San Francisco with his fiancée, Joey Drayton (Katharine Houghton), to meet his future in-laws, Matt and Christina Drayton (Spencer Tracy and Katharine Hepburn). Little do they know, their conservative parents are about to face a challenge they never saw coming.
Breaking Barriers, One Dinner at a Time
In the 1960s, interracial relationships were still a taboo subject, making Guess Who's Coming to Dinner a bold and progressive film for its time. Poitier, known for his roles in groundbreaking films like To Sir, with Love and In the Heat of the Night, once again breaks barriers with his portrayal of John Prentice.
John and Joey's love story is a testament to the power of love and acceptance, challenging societal norms and preconceived notions. The film's narrative is a powerful reminder that love knows no color, a message that resonates as strongly today as it did back then.
The Dream Team: Poitier, Tracy, and Hepburn
Guess Who's Coming to Dinner brought together three of Hollywood's most revered actors: Sidney Poitier, Spencer Tracy, and Katharine Hepburn. Their on-screen chemistry is palpable, as they navigate the complexities of their characters' relationships.
- Poitier delivers a nuanced performance as John, balancing strength and vulnerability with ease. - Tracy, in one of his final roles, brings his signature charm and wisdom to Matt Drayton, a man struggling to reconcile his progressive ideals with his own prejudices. - Hepburn, as Christina, is a force to be reckoned with, delivering a powerful performance that earned her an Academy Award for Best Actress.
Their collective talent elevates the film, turning what could have been a simple domestic drama into a poignant exploration of love, family, and societal expectations.
A Feast of Dialogue and Emotion
Guess Who's Coming to Dinner is a feast for the eyes and the mind, with sharp, witty dialogue that packs an emotional punch. The film's script, penned by William Rose, is a masterclass in subtlety and nuance, deftly navigating complex themes with humor and heart.
The dinner scene, in particular, is a tour de force of acting and writing. As the Draytons and their guests gather around the table, tensions rise, and secrets are revealed, culminating in a powerful climax that leaves no one unaffected.
